Output 3d8c66082017a8e73bb1e45f934ec2c1d4edcd0a4114ed0b163043ef77bf0776:1

value
10914036
script pubkey
OP_0 OP_PUSHBYTES_20 26e3aca61d1fb0a26233d8a844662d2abfc5f0fe
address
bc1qym36efsar7c2yc3nmz5yge3d92lutu87scs2uq
transaction
3d8c66082017a8e73bb1e45f934ec2c1d4edcd0a4114ed0b163043ef77bf0776
confirmations
35719
spent
true